Summary

For decades, hotels worldwide have followed the same rule. Check in after two in the afternoon, check out before noon the next day. Most travelers never question it. But some Chinese hotel chains are now tearing up that script, letting guests keep their room for a full twenty-four hours from check-in. Travelers love the idea. Yet for hotels, the reality is more complicated. On the show: Steve, Yushan & Yushun
